* Paul Johnston proposed a centrally hosted plugin registry and a

package-manager, with submission template requiring documentation

Advantages:

- solves other short-comings of current plug-in-anarchy in the same move

Disadvantages:

- as Johannes Schindelin underlined (I concur), if there is to much of

a burden to share a plug-in, developers won't bother sharing.

- a lot of work to create the infrastructure (but cf Fiji)
